Finding Your Perfect Participants: A Guide to Recruitment Strategies for UX Research

Conducting successful user experience (UX) research hinges on gathering a representative group of participants. These individuals provide invaluable insights that shape services. Effectively recruiting the right people can be challenging, but with a well-defined UX research strategy, you can enhance your research impact.

  • Start by clearly specifying your desired participant profile. What are their characteristics? What are their goals? A detailed sketch will direct your recruitment approaches
  • Secondly, explore various channels to attract potential participants. This could comprise online forums, social media platforms, professional associations, or even personal networks
  • Keep in mind to compensate participants for their time and participation. This shows appreciation for their help and can boost response rates.

Conducting Effective User Interviews: Best Practices and Techniques

User interviews are crucial for gaining knowledge into user needs and behaviors. For conduct effective user interviews, adhere to these best practices and techniques: First, carefully structure your interview questions to guarantee that they are concise. Next, create a relaxed environment for your users. Pay attention actively to their feedback and pose follow-up questions to uncover deeper understanding.

Furthermore, remain objective and avoid influencing your users' responses. Finally, summarize the interviews accurately to enable future analysis and practical insights.

By implementing these best practices, you can carry out user interviews that provide meaningful intelligence to improve your product or offering.
